The Torch of Ixli

 

52635436b63f4a22f5e1d49ad6a809dd.png

(Zaagesh, the Lesser Spirit of Truth and Judgement)

 

The world exists in a contrast of positive and negative energies; the perfect split of a former union which bore nout but persistent inaction. Indeed, it is these opposing factors that cause the entropy of life. For the light cannot be recognised unless it is held against the looming darkness, nor the cleansing heat of friction known but for the cold, still embrace that serves to contrast it.

 

Indeed the truth of life is that no pursuit can hold any merit, lest there be a contrast to guide it; A merchant cannot sell where none wish to consume, and a soldier may not fight against himself. As such, the seeker of Truth must venture into the darkest realms in pursuit of understanding.

 

For so long has Vaasek watched over the Mortal Realms, hidden and obscured in illusion. His many servants, the Kabalees, serve intently upon the realms of Men in disguise, influencing civilisations and religions with their dark and looming presence. Such is the power of this Daemon that his mass deception has gone unobserved for countless decades. However, all secrets are lain bear with the passing of time, and Vaasek would be no exception to this.

 

With the growing madness in the world, and the increasing numbers of Ish’Urkal that consume with a hunger that knows no equal, Ixli, the Spirit of Forbidden Knowledge, Truth and Judgement had grown to such lengths that his abilities became more heightened than usual.

 

Empowered by this newfound capability, Ixli dared venture further into the Forbidden Realms, accessing knowledge that would come at high prices; indeed a process the Spirit was not unfamiliar with. He used these arts to access the Elemental Realms directly, in search of a relic that settled betwixt the dimensions of Binazdar and Razlab, the Elemental Lords of Light and Darkness, respectively.

 

There would lay the intertwined links of light and darkness, a series of chains that interlocked in one another, representing the necessity of the two to remain within some semblance of balance. Yet before the Lords could take heed, the chains had been stolen, and Ixli soon returned to his realm.

 

Knowing well the effects wearing such a relic would offer, Ixli decided not to adorn himself, and instead offered them to his most powerful Lesser: Zaagesh.

 

When the Spirit bore the chains, his form drained into a pale complexion, and his appearance began to resemble more bone than flesh. Before long, a shroud of darkness enveloped his head, of which no shade of black could compare, and wings of equal shade sprouted from his back as he writhed in agony.

 

He had become the personification of light and dark, an entity that bore the weight of both realms, and saw all distortion of it that lay upon the Mortal Realm. The chains that he had worn had formed into a staff that settled firmly in his grasp, and with each swing cast a swathe of cleansing fire in its wake.


The Torch of Ixli had been born, a servant that existed to reveal all that was hidden in the world. One that would burn away the falsities and deception so commonplace among the Mortal Realm.

 

A vessel of Judgement.


 

The Zaniil

 

UAujXc1SQR1Xnk2-YWyiIX8Vu5kilzC-s-uISOPJ0QpRTadaN600OhSuUqT54R-MeX6KDYDjmyqGHCIaWOKQa4Y2elSOR4Y2YKxVtiY_f47LDptTKlT1aVjgKQ5U3N3ZmmKlSZzZ

(A Zaniil inspecting an Arcane Rose)
 

As per the chaos of existence, it was not long before Zaagesh began to succumb to the latent corruptions wrought upon Ixli’s realm, and soon he descended into a state of utter madness. Encapsulated by his pursuit to expose all deception, he sought out just and virtuous Mortals that could help him in his endeavour, offering them small links of the Ruum which would bestow remarkable power upon them.

 

These Mortals would begin to warp and change as Zaagesh had done years before, and would bear an almost albino complexion as their hair and skin began to pale to an almost pure white. They would become the Zaniil, creatures that were made to scout out Illusion and Deception and utterly destroy it. They would harness the powers of the Ruum to do this, which would grant them the ability to produce a cleansing flame that does not harm that which adorns no veil of disguise. Once they accept the Ruum, it forever distorts their soul, and will proceed to take on the shape of a staff or weapon.



The Stages and Capabilities of this Transformation

 

 

Stage One, Tier 1

 

54458e738fea777cfc7b37c046cffb6d.png

(The eyes often reflect the darkness latent in the Mortal Realm as the Zaniil adjusts to the horrific experience of the Ruum)
 

Upon receiving a part of the Ruum, the prospective Zaniil will experience all darkness and light in the world in a series of chaotic moments. However, because the chain has been torn from the balance of Light and Darkness, it exists out of the natural balance, and offers each experience in extremes that fluctuate.

 

The initiate will descend into the depths of despair, and emerge in a euphoric state of no comparison, before being plunged once again into hell in a series of events that shake their core and align their Soul with the chain.

 

Once they have experienced this, their appearance will grow pale, and their eyes will momentarily glaze over in darkness when an apparent Illusion is presented.Additionally, their hands will begin to turn an ashen black and they form into clawed appendages. At this stage, there is very little they can achieve, and instead they must learn to harness their mana in a way that will force the Light and Dark within them to hold within balance.

 

The Ruum will begin to form into a weapon or staff, but will not be capable of harnessing the Flame until Stage Two.

At this stage in their development, the Zaniil will rarely resemble the Mortals they once were, and will instead appear as pale creatures with ivory horns, their claws now developed and their eyes a crimson hue. They will however, retain their body mass, for their strength is not heightened or lessened by this effect.

 

These Zaniil are capable of using the Flame, and may spark small embers in an attempt to remove weak Illusions and Deceptions, and may begin to see flickers of the Kabalees that roam the world, appearing as hazed light in their perception.

 

To harness the Flame, the Zaniil must utilise their former training in maintaining a balance between light and dark, so that they may restore the balance within the Mortal Realm, thus rendering the Illusion weakened. The Flame is used to remove Illusion, and cannot harm anything else. The colouration of the flame will be the same as the eyes of the user.

At this stage the Zaniil will have eyes of a yellow colouration, and will be able to perceive Illusion and Deception more effectively. They can also more effectively utilise the Flame, and may produce larger flames that can remove medium strength Illusions; those of equivalent tier.

 

However, at this stage the Insanity of Ixli begins to seep into their minds, and the Zaniil are prone to bouts of bloodlust as their eyes begin to trick them into perceiving Illusion where there is none. Their mind also begins to spread falsities within them, causing a rupture of inner sanctum which makes them increasingly more hostile to the world.

A Lord of Judgement and cleansing, those at Tier 4 are quite capable of sensing Illusions of the highest degree, and can terminate that which they uncover with their Flame. So stark is their ability that an ever present flame illuminates overhead, and their eyes form a hue of orange that reflects it.

 

At this stage the Zaniil has succumbed to madness, and is lost in the pursuit of Truth, choosing to perceive distortion where there is none in an attempt to enact Judgement.
